Bradford Pear Tree Pruning in Doylestown, PA
Bradford Pear Tree Pruning services focus on maintaining the health, appearance, and safety of these popular ornamental trees. This service typically involves removing dead or diseased branches, shaping the tree for a balanced and attractive form, and reducing the risk of limbs breaking during storms. Projects may range from light trimming to more extensive pruning, especially for trees that have become overgrown or are located near structures or walkways. Homeowners often request this service to enhance curb appeal, prevent potential property damage, or promote the overall vitality of their Bradford Pears.
Before requesting Bradford Pear Tree Pruning, property owners should consider the current condition of the trees, including any signs of disease or structural issues. It is helpful to identify specific goals such as improving tree shape, removing hazardous branches, or encouraging healthy growth. Understanding the timing of pruning, typically during dormancy or early spring, can also influence the results. Clear communication about these details can ensure the pruning work meets the desired outcomes for both aesthetic and safety reasons.

Bradford Pear Tree Pruning Questions
Why is Bradford Pear Tree pruning important? Proper pruning helps maintain tree health, promotes balanced growth, and improves overall appearance.
When is the best time to prune Bradford Pear Trees? The ideal time is during late winter or early spring before new growth begins.
What pruning techniques are used for Bradford Pear Trees? Techniques include removing dead or diseased branches, thinning out crowded areas, and shaping the canopy.
Are there any risks associated with pruning Bradford Pear Trees? Improper pruning can lead to weak branch attachments or disease, so professional techniques are recommended.
